Understanding Cervical Fractures
Cervical fractures typically result from high-energy trauma such as motor vehicle accidents, falls from significant heights, sports injuries, or direct blows to the neck. They may also occur in the context of underlying bone pathology, such as osteoporosis or metastatic disease. The cervical spine's unique anatomy, with its high mobility and proximity to the spinal cord, makes these injuries particularly concerning.

Clinical Presentation and Diagnosis
Symptoms of Cervical Fractures
Patients with cervical fractures may present with:
- Neck pain and tenderness
- Limited range of motion
- Neurological deficits (weakness, numbness, paralysis)
- Loss of sensation
- Headache
- Signs of spinal cord injury, such as paralysis or incontinence
In severe cases, patients may exhibit signs of respiratory compromise due to high cervical cord involvement.
Diagnostic Approach
The evaluation of suspected cervical fractures involves:
- History and Physical Examination
- Assessment of trauma mechanism
- Neurological examination
- Evaluation for other injuries
- Imaging Studies
- X-ray: Initial assessment for fracture visualization
- CT scan: Gold standard for detailed bone assessment
- MRI: Evaluates soft tissue, ligamentous injuries, and spinal cord involvement
Timely diagnosis is critical to prevent secondary neurological damage.
Management Strategies
Treatment of cervical fractures depends on the fracture type, stability, neurological status, and patient factors.
Conservative Management
Applicable in stable fractures without neurological deficits:
- Cervical immobilization with a neck brace or collar
- Close monitoring
- Pain management
- Physical therapy
Surgical Intervention
Indicated for unstable fractures, dislocations, or neurological compromise:
- Open reduction and internal fixation (ORIF)
- Cervical fusion
- Decompression procedures
Surgical decision-making requires multidisciplinary collaboration involving neurosurgeons, orthopedic surgeons, and trauma specialists.
Rehabilitation and Follow-up
Post-treatment rehabilitation focuses on:
- Restoring mobility and strength
- Preventing complications such as bedsores or thromboembolism
- Addressing neurological deficits
Long-term follow-up includes imaging to monitor healing and alignment.
